Years ago the series had more scenes. The platforms are cutting them without warning

The seasons of the series streaming They are increasingly shorter, and not always by creative decision. Behind the cuts are skyrocketing production costs, subscriber retention strategies and, sometimes, decisions made from the accounting department and not from the writers’ table. The phenomenon is so broad that it also affects altered versions of classic series, eliminating scenes and changing soundtracks without warning. This episode is not how I remembered. You are reviewing a series that you already know and something goes wrong: a scene that you remembered clearly does not appear. Or the opening credits song sounds different. Or the final episode ends earlier than it should. It is not always a failure of your memory. Often, the version you see in front of you is not the same as the one you saw back in the day. This phenomenon has gained visibility in recent months thanks to users who document on social networks the differences between versions, and its scope is greater than it seems. The platforms of streaming They offer, in many cases and without realizing it, degraded or cut versions of series and movies. The reasons behind these decisions are multiple. Sustained contraction. Before entering into the phenomenon of cuts without notice, it is worth remembering some facts. According to the firm Parrot Analyticsthe average number of episodes per season on free-to-air television fell from 16.2 in 2018 to 11.8 in July 2024. On streaming platforms streamingwhich already started from shorter seasons, have also contracted: from 10.7 episodes on average in 2018 to 9.3 in the same period. Some studies talk that production companies and platforms are increasingly stingy when it comes to renewing or ordering series: they simply ask for fewer episodes. One last piece of information about this reduction: in 2025, the number of original series streaming fell by 11% year-on-year. Beyond those series that suffer, against the will of their creators, cuts in the number of their episodes (as it happened at the time with ‘The House of the Dragon’), there are cuts from series already broadcast. For example, the final episode of ‘Friday Night Lights’, which is now on Filmin (in its shortened version) had a duration of more than 60 minutes. When it moved to NBC for free-to-air broadcast, it was cut to less than 45 minutes to fit with advertising. Complete scenes are missing from this mutilated version. Here we can see a similar case with an episode of ‘The Bill Cosby Hour’ streaming. Music, another point of friction. The licensing rights for musical themes do not always extend to all platforms or expire after a period of time, which requires replacing original songs with others. When ‘The Wonder Years’ arrived on Netflix in 2011 after years of being blocked by rights issues, numerous songs had been replaced, including Joe Cocker’s iconic version of ‘With a Little Help from My Friends’ that opened each episode. In ‘Dawson Grows’, Paula Cole’s original tune was replaced in streaming by a Jann Arden song; The fan outcry was so intense that Cole ended up re-recording his own song. It is a common problem, which has meant that legendary series like ‘Luz de Luna’ or ‘Búscate la vida’ have spent years without being able to be seen, not even in domestic formats (in the case of Chris Peterson’s legendary series, we are still waiting). The war of the formats. We’ve already talked about itbut it is not bad to remember that the image format has been manipulated on countless occasions to adapt it to widescreen televisions. The case of ‘The Simpsons’ is perhaps the most popularsince many jokes with the original square format of the first seasons were lost. Also The case of ‘Buffy the Vampire Slayer’ is popular‘, which in its panoramic format and retouched colors makes the illusion of night scenes from the original series disappear and allows the filming crew and sets to be seen. A disaster that can only be solved by going to the first editions on DVD before their “remastering”. What to do to solve it. One more time: do not completely rule out the physical format. China is cutting distances with the US in AI with the best that is given: observe

Although artificial intelligence applications that are most used in the world usually come from US companies, China is silently climbing positions through a strategy with many legs. A strategy that not only focuses on computing, but also on building solid foundations around this industry. As WSJ points outfrom multinational banks to public universities, organizations around the world are adopting AI models developed by companies such as Deepseek or alibaba as an alternative to American solutions. There is still a great job ahead, but the popularity of its language models begins to shoot worldwide. A silent revolution. While Chatgpt is still the most popular chatbot in the world with 910 million downloads Faced with the 125 million DEPEEEK, according to the Tower Sensor Analysis firm, real competition is not measured only in end users. Banks like HSBC and Standard Chartered They have begun to prove internally the Depseek modelsthe Saudi Aramco oil company has installed this technology in its main data center, and even American giants such as Amazon Web Services, Microsoft and Google offer Deepseek to their customers. The Chinese strategy is clear: to offer a performance up at considerably lower prices. The dynamic is being similar to the one that the country has been applying in the rest of industries: observe around it, then innovate and then dominate with competitive prices. China’s secret weapon: 3.5 million engineers per year. For decades, China has meticulously built Its arsenal of human capital in Stem disciplines (Science, Technology, Engineering and Mathematics). The country annually graduates 3.57 million engineers, four times more than the United States. This advantage is not accidental: since the 80s, China shipment massively students to Western universities in the phenomenon known as “Hai Gui” (sea turtles), which returned to transform Chinese academic institutions. Universities like Tsinghua They have come to overcome Stanford or Mit in number of relevant scientific studies. The master plan began with the “four modernizations“De Deng Xiaoping, who prioritized technical and scientific education with a long -term vision. Today, education spending has not come down from 4% of GDP In two decades, and incentives to publish quality research can reach $ 100,000 per study. The result: 38% of AI experts who work in the United States were formed in Chinese universities. How China is gaining ground. The Chinese strategy combines three key elements: First: An approach to practical applications of AI against the American search for superintelligence. While Openai and other American companies pursue revolutionary advances, Chinese companies focus on solving immediate market problems. Second: The release of open source models that allow developers around the world to adapt them freely. Alibaba has seen how more than 100,000 derived models are created based on its Qwenand in other institutions, such as the University of Witwatersrand in South Africa, They have chosen Deepseek for your projects due to your Open-Source nature and to be able to use it without connection to guarantee the safety of your data. Third: aggressive prices that are irresistible for emerging markets. On platforms such as Latenode, which helps companies around the world to create personalized AI tools, one in five global companies already choose Deepseek Being “17 times cheaper” than US alternatives, according to Oleg Zankov, co -founder of Latenode. This strategy is especially effective in countries where money and computing power are more limited. A COLD TECHNOLOGICAL WAR. This competition is fracturing the global ecosystem of AI in two blocks. USA has tightened chips exports restrictionswhile China massively invests in building an independent supply chain. The result is a division in which countries and companies must choose between American or Chinese systems. And while Washington tries to limit Chinese access to technology, American companies themselves integrate Chinese solutions in their services. Innovation, talent and prices. The competition will intensify on multiple fronts. China is revolutionizing its search engines: Baidu has just launched The greatest update of its platform In a decade, allowing searches for more than a thousand characters compared to the previous 28, complete integration with AI and multimodal capabilities that include voice, images and files. It is a direct response to the Deepseek pressure at the national level and other conversational platforms. Meanwhile, Chinese talent is still courted by American technological ones: goal has recently signed To four key Chinese engineers of OpenAI, who have contributed greatly in models such as GPT-4 and O3. Paradoxically, while Trump threatens to revoke visas to Chinese students For national security, the American industry depends more and more on this talent. What is clear is that the country that achieves the broader adoption of its technology in the rest of the world will have a huge advantage. Some employees sued their company for cutting the salary. The supreme has responded that being unpunctual is not a job

The working day is much more than a simple time convention. From the labor reform of 2021, in which the SCHEDULE HOURS REGISTRATION As a method to measure Time really workedhas become a factor that conditions the salary that the employee must receive. Both when working More hours of the agreedlike when it doesn’t meet them. That is precisely what the Supreme Court had to remind them of the collective claim of a group of workers filed against their employer. If you do not meet your schedule and you are late, You will charge less. What happened? As you can read in The Supreme Court Judgmenta group of workers, represented by their union links, said that, due to the distance between the system of day registration And the employee’s job, every day they were counted between one and three minutes of delay, which was added monthly. The employees complained that, when doing the payrolls, the company discounted that time not worked on their salary, so they received less than agreed. What do employees claim? Workers recognize that Importuality It is a reason for sanction contemplated in the collective agreement of the company, but does not apply to salary reduction for that reason. Instead, it should be done through other types of warnings or compensation since the agreement is governed by a certain amount of annual hours, not for daily days. In this way, the company could ask employees to compensate for that time at any other time of the year, avoiding salary cut. Employees consider that, delays the delays of their salary, they would be imposing a double sanction and incurring a type of sanction called “Fine of having“, in which salary amounts are subtracted or sanctions on vacations or holidays are applied. A practice prohibited by article 58.3 of the Workers Statute. What does the Supreme Court say? The sentence of the High Court bases its argument to give the reason to the company in article 26.1 of the Statute of the Workers in which it is specified: “The totality of the economic perceptions of the workers, in money or in kind, for the professional benefit of the labor services in an alienation, and the effective work, whatever the form of remuneration, or the computable rest periods as a computable rest periods,” will be considered salary. The supreme considers that salary Back the work Cash or the computable rest time as work, while in article 30 of the Workers’ Statute it is established that “the worker will keep the right to his salary if he does not provide services for cause to the employer and not the worker.” Therefore, “during the time when the worker does not provide labor services, having an obligation to do so, without any justification, the sinalagmatic character of the employment contract assumes that salary is not accrued, without this implying a fine of having.” That is, since the unpunctuality was not produced for any reason attributable to the company, and the time of delay is not considered effective working timethe company is in its right not to pay it, without being considered as a sanction. Not that they don’t pay you, they can fire you. The Supreme Court specifies that the “fine of having” applies when it occurs in a salary cut or benefits to which the worker is entitled. However, in this case, “the worker has no right to receive said salary because he has not provided services for causes only to him,” the sentence abounds. In other words: the company does not have to pay for a job that the employee has not done and, therefore, cannot apply any penalty about something that does not correspond to it. In addition, the Supreme Court rules out the assumption of the double sanction since it has been shown that it is something that employees have no right because they have not provided the service that justifies it, although it indicates that “a contractual breach that, if reiterated, justifies the exercise of disciplinary power by the employer.” That is, that the company is not obliged to pay for the time that has not been worked, but can impose disciplinary measures on employees (and even cause with dismissal) by repeated breach of your contract without just cause. We have discovered that cutting the consumption of an amino acid is related to more life expectancy. In mice, yes

Virtually anything, in excess, can end up being harmful. Water is no exception and amino acids, the “bricks of life” are not. This was demonstrated by a study conducted from one of those compounds. In moderation. In study, conducted in mice, noticed that cutting the intake of isoleucine in the diet of animals helped increase the life expectancy of rodents by 33%. Isoleucine. Isoleucine is one of the essential amino acids. Amino acids are essential molecules for life as they represent The links from which proteins are created. We know thousands of proteins, all of them composed from about twenty amino acids. Our body can synthesize more than half of the amino acids that it requires to create proteins, but nine of these amino acids, the so -called essential, we must obtain them from our food. This is the case of isoleucine, an amino acid that we can find in a diversity of foods such as eggs, soybeans, meat and fish. A previous track. The study started from a Previous indication. A study conducted ten years ago in the state of Wisconsin observed that the diets of people with obesity were richer in this amino acid than the average population. In mice. For Study this correlationthe team went to the laboratory and studied its effect on mice. Laboratory animals divided into three groups: one control, to which no food restrictions were applied, another whose diet was altered to reduce the presence of amino acids, and another whose diet was normal in the presence of amino acids except in Isoleucine. The amount of isoleucine that this group received was ⅔ less than the standard. The mice were six months when they started these diets, which would be equivalent to an age of 30 years in humans. Analziating results. The team observed that the two groups of mice with amino acid restiring lost body fat at the beginning but those who had all the restricted amino acids lost it again soon. More important, the team observed that mice in this diet with less isoleucine increased their life expectancy: 7% in females and 33% in males. Another relevant detail that they observed is that the mice in this diet would ingest more calories. Possibly, they point out, to compensate for the lack of nutritional contribution of this component. Despite this, they also burned more of these calories, which led them to maintain a lower body mass than the rest of the study mice. The details of the study were published In an article In the magazine Cell metabolism. And what about humans? The team responsible for the study was likely that the restriction of this amino acid can have a similar effect on humans. For now that possibility is little more than speculative but the fact that the greatest presence of this amino acid in the diets of people with obesity is already observed implies another indication of the existence of some relationship. Beyond the biological differences between one species, the human diet is much less controllable than that of laboratory mice. The field of nutrition is extremely complex, with an infinity of nutrients, some of which interact with each other. He effect of other factors As our physical activity or tobacco consumption also affect our health and our life expectancy, making it difficult to elucidate the net impact of a nutrient on the human body. In full nervousness for the cutting of submarine cables, China has a final weapon: a radio in steroids

The Submarine cables They are one of the most important elements today. Not only is it a huge infrastructure that organizations and companies continue to develop -with such ambitious projects as the Meta cablewhich will take more than one return to the earth-but have become today thanks to the Ukraine War already maneuvers at the South China Sea. It is in this conflict that Some cut cables They have triggered the fear of running out of the Internet, and everything that implies. These cables are protected, but can be damaged by ships. Now, China has presented a device designed with a task in mind: cut underwater cables. And it is the first time that someone announces that he has a tool capable of interrupting critical underwater networks. The importance of cables. There are more than 1.4 billion meters of submarine cables that connect all countries. There are other thousands of kilometers planned, and the vast majority of communications in some countries depend on these cables. 95% of them in the case of Australiafor example, and I know esteem that 95% of the data managed by the American population and 75% by China depend on them. They are vital for the Internet and all that this implies, such as streaming, artificial intelligence or servers, and this year they have become protagonists in war scenarios. Countries in conflict have realized that they can cause great damage by cutting these cables by boats or through more sophisticated techniques, such as Sound attacks. There are times that They are simple accidentsbut the suspicion that a damaged underwater cable corresponds to an enemy attack is something that is there. And more now with what they just announced from China. The Chinese device. As we read in South China Morning Postthe State Key Laboratory of Deep Water Crewing Vehicles and the Scientific Research Center of Ships of China, have developed a tool that describe as “compact” and that is capable of cutting the most sophisticated underwater communication lines or energy in the world. As it is a tool designed specifically for this, it has been conceived to cut cables at depths of up to 4,000 meters. There are no cables right now that they are in such depth, but its creators have provided the device with a completely sealed titanium alloy housing to resist that enormous pressure. This is Haidu, and can carry this “radial” Your weapons. The device is equipped with a kilowatt engine and as a cutting tool uses a 150 millimeter diamond wheel that rotates at 1,600 revolutions per minute. Let’s say it is the mixture between a protected drone to endure very high pressures and a radial. This cutting tool allows to destroy up to armored cables that have steel layers, rubber and polymeric coating. And its form has been designed so that it can be integrated both in manned and non -manned submersibles of China. For example, haidou vehicles or Fondouzhe could have this as one of their tools. He Haiduas a curiosity, it is an unmanned submersible in the form of fish and eyes drawings and fins created for exploration. He Fendouzhe It is a manned submarine, also for research and exploration. World Order. As we say, threaten to cut underwater cables It is not something new. We have seen it in the Ukraine War, but it is the first time that a country officially reveals a tool designed exclusively for that task. Of course, those responsible affirm that the tool has been created for civil purposes. Which is it? Rescue and mining operations in the maritime bed, but it is evident that it is a tool that is surely causing the other neck itching in rulers around the world. It is clear that such a tool can destabilize communications in a crisis and be used strategically during an attack. And it is not only communication, but everything that has to do with the Internet, such as servers and services that depend on them. Debate and consequences. When a cable is cut, communications are rapidly redirected through another, since they are prepared to have a large bandwidth. Therefore, important interruptions are not usually produced, but that cable You have to repair itbeing a fairly expensive process. Now, when it is not a single cut cable, but several, that connection may be set. It is what has led to a debate about the need to protect infrastructure. NATO has launched The mission “Baltic Sentry” To patrol sensitive regions with airplanes, drones and warships. There are also companies that are offering advanced cable monitoring services, answering all measures to a single issue: the protection of infrastructure and early detection to prevent cuts. That there are countries that have already made public that have sophisticated tools for cutting submarine cables and interfering with world geopolitics, is a new headache. In Spain, cutting urban trees looks like national sport. These Swiss have just demonstrated that it is a mistake

There is only a handful of things that we know for sure about cities and one of them is that trees are key. And it is that the exposure to green spaces (and there the trees enter) “is associated with lower risks of mortality.” It’s simple, it’s clear, it’s easy. And, despite this, we do not take note. Wait, wait a moment … how? Yes and There are many reasons To do this: trees filter air pollutants, provide shadow, reduce ambient temperature in warm climates and encourage people to spend more time outdoors. They are a cheap and relatively accessible system to improve people’s lives. But, as I say, when planting trees it is not so easy. Among other things because there is no space. How can we plant trees to get maximum benefit? That is what They wondered Zurich ETH researchers. To do this, they examined high resolution data of the tree canopy to determine “the structure of the green tree spaces” within a radius of 500 meters of the place of residence of a person. Of six million people, actually. AND They crossed this urban data with health and mortality information from the neighborhoods of Europe and Asia that analyzed. What have you discovered? That both tree coverage in residential areas and its spatial distribution correlates with mortality. In fact, researchers They realized that the risk of mortality was “significantly lower in people living in neighborhoods with extensive, adjacent and well -interconnected areas of tree cups than in people who live in areas with less areas of fragmented tree glasses and with complex geometries.” This seems true, in addition, if we discount other factors such as age, wealth, gender or educational level. It is true that the data are correlational and, therefore, do not allow to establish causal relationships; But the effect size makes all this very promising. But, indeed, research is needed. “We are still in the early stages of this research”, The researchers explained. There are very basic things that are there to be clear: for example, they did not study the influence of specific factors such as pre -existing diseases, smoking or the same use of these green spaces. A big problem … that affects us especially. And I say it affects Spain because Bad care that urban trees are given here is An endemic problem. The causes are diverse, yes; But they can be summarized in three: few media, mismanagement and isolated political decisions of any current technical knowledge. Swiss study is just the last drop of a glass to be overflowing. Because we have known for a long time that trees help reduce atmospheric pollutants and mitigate the Urban heat island effect; But we don’t take it seriously. Nor do we go to take it. Taiwan has just stopped a ship after cutting an underwater cable. The problem is that there are only Chinese citizens inside

That the submarine cables, whether communications or energy, have become a first level actor in the geopolitics of the planet, is out of any doubt. The cases of cuts and Sabotajes that have occurred in recent months, together with The huge investments They are taking place among companies with AI in the equation, attest to it. However, if the cable cut occurs in a high voltage place such as Taiwan, the incident acquires another channel. The suspicion of sabotage. It is not the first time in the enclave, like We have counted beforebut it has happened again. The authorities of Taiwan have stopped a ship of load under the suspicion of having cut a communications cable Submarine that connects the main island with the Penghu archipelago, located about 30 kilometers west. Although the investigation is still ongoing, the event adds to a series of similar incidents that have generated restlessness on possible tactics of maritime sabotage by China and Russia. The problem: the ship is manned by Chinese citizens. The arrest. A Taiwanese coach detected That the vessel, a freighter in poor condition with multiple names and Chinese financing, was in the area when the cable rupture occurred. According to Ou Yu-FEI, spokesman for the Coast Guard, it was The only ship present In the area at that time, which reinforces the hypothesis of its involvement. In addition, they say that the ship could have used a false registration number and changed its name suddenly, a common pattern in covert activities. Context of a “possible.” As has told the New York Timesthe incident occurred around Tuesday at 3:24 am, shortly after a Taiwanese patrol ordered the freighter to leave the area because they were too close to the submarine cables with the anchor thrown. This detail has led the authorities to consider the possibility that the ship took advantage of its exit to perform a deliberate act of sabotage. Crucial cables. The cutting of submarine communications cables is always a serious accident, but in the case of Taiwan a little more. The reason? It depends on Great measure of these cables for its connectivity with its peripheral islands and with the rest of the world. While they can be damaged by natural causes such as earthquakes or aging of the material, the most common reason is the drag of ships of ships or fishing nets. In fact and as we remembered, recent patterns have led some analysts to speculate that China and Russia could be resorting to deliberate sabotage as a form of harassment in the sea. A trend. A summary of the growing number of similar cases could be made in recent times. In 2023a cable between Taiwan and the Matsu Islands was cut, affecting communications for weeks. TO beginnings of 2025a digital cable that connects Taiwan with South Korea, Japan, China and the United States suffered damage, indicated that a Chinese ship could have dragged its anchor over it. In November 2024two fiber optic cables in the Baltic Sea were cut, and the investigations pointed to a Chinese/Russian flag freighter. In response to this trend, the Taiwan government has intensified surveillance of its underwater infrastructure and has prepared a list of More than 50 suspicious shipsmany of them registered with convenience flags (such as the togolesa, used by the detainee ship). The answer. A few hours ago, China has accused Taiwan of politically manipulate the recent incident of the submarine cable. According to Beijing, the Taiwanese government has exaggerated the situation without conclusive evidence, with the aim of feeding tensions and obtaining political revenue. Zhu Fenglian, spokesman for the Chinese Government’s Taiwan Affairs Office, minimized the same, stating that damage to submarine cables They are common maritime accidents that occur more than a hundred times a year worldwide. In addition, he accused the Democratic Progressive Party (PPD), which governs Taiwan, to use the event to manipulate public opinion without their claims having real support. For its part, the Taiwanese government has rejected Beijing’s claims, insisting that there are clear indications of possible sabotage, especially since the ship with Chinese links was present in the area when it occurred. Geopolitical implications. If Taiwan’s suspicions are confirmed about intentional damage, the fact could climb the tensions between the island and China. As We have been countingBeijin considers Taiwan as part of its territory and has increased pressure on the island in recent years through military incursionseconomic pressure and cyber attacks. We will have to wait, since the case has been sent to prosecutors to deeper investigation. Meanwhile, the island continues reinforcing your measures security to avoid new interruptions in their underwater communications. In a context in which the control of digital networks and critical infrastructure has become a hybrid war tool, these incidents reinforce the perception that the “neighbor” could be exploring forms of indirect destabilization without reaching an open conflict . China has been cutting its technology for years. Xi Jiping has just opened the door for that to change

Jack Ma, “The Jeff Bezos de China”, It seemed to go directly to stardom. And what happened is that he crashed when he tried to launch Ant Financial Its alleged Fintech of 150,000 million dollars. Or rather, Xi Jinping, the Chinese president who made clear Who was commanded. Ma finished practically missing in actionbut now it has just appeared in an event with Jinping and other great executives of Chinese technology companies. That this happens is as surprising as it is interesting. XI Jinping Meeting with Technological Capos “in China. As they point out In Bloombergthe Chinese president presided on Monday a meeting in which several entrepreneurs and managers of large Chinese technology companies participated. Among them, of course, the presence of Jack Ma, co -founder of Alibaba – and who left the position of CEO in 2019 – that for the first time in years went to an event of this caliber. The major flat. The event was also attended among Ren Zhengfei (Founder and CEO of Huawei), Wang Chuanfu (Founder and CEO of Byd), Pony Ma (CEO of Tencent), Lei Jun (co -founder and CEO of Xiaomi), Wang Xing (CoFundador and CEO from Meituan) or Wang Xingxing (CEO of Unitree Robotics). Apparently nor Robin Li (CEO of Baidu) Ni Yiming Zhang (CEO of Bytedance) went to that event. During the event, they point out in The New York Times, XI asked these entrepreneurs to have the “ambition to serve the country.” And also the richest. The 2024 Forbes list With the richest people in China, it demonstrates that the technological and automobile sector is especially notable in terms of presence. Thus, if we search that list to the personalities of the technological segment in China we see many examples (with its position in that list in parentheses): Pony Ma (Aliaba) (2) Zhang Yiming (bytedance) (3) Colin Huang (Temu/Shein) (4) Robin Zeng (catl) (5) William ding (netease) (7) Jack Ma (ex-alibaba) (8) Wang Chuanfu (Byd) (9) Lei Jun (Xiaomi) (10) Those fortunes, of course, are far from the great fortunes that dominate the Forbes list globally. Thus, Pony Ma, the second greatest fortune in China, is the fortune 57 of the world. Lei Jun, in the 10th position of ranking in China, is 195 in the global ranking. More love for private companies. The meeting seems to point to a possible change in attitude on the part of the Chinese government, which in recent years has left the great Chinese technology act, but always making it clear who sent. AI can have a lot to do. The moment in which the meeting occurs coincides with the rapid development of AI models created by startups and Chinese companies. The actions of these companies have shown the renewed interest in the great Chinese technology: Tencent, who has just offered Deepseek R1 in Wechat, He marked The price record in the Chinese stock market in the last four years. China became hard with its technology. Ma ended up scalding after the terrible episode lived with Ant Group Co., and other executives seemed to learn the lesson. The government campaign launched at that time was responsible for reinforcing state control over the economy and stopping Chinese billionaires. The objective: to reorient resources towards the priorities of XI, such as national security and technological self -sufficiency. Closer to Xi Jinping’s policies. Since then Chinese technology companies have been much more aligned with the philosophy of Chinese president. Thus, the AI ​​models developed by some of these companies must first receive the approval of the government to be able to deploy and use in the country. More tolerance for private. In recent times Beijing has been softening its restrictive policies against Chinese private companies: Qwen, Alibaba’s model, is demonstrating the increasing relevance of the company in this field, but even Apple is managing to include its Apple Intelligence platform On the iPhone in China thanks to their agreements precisely with Alibaba. Chinese Millanoriocracy. In the US we are seeing how the great technological fortunes are aligned with Trump and yield to their policies or even drive them, as is the case of Elon Musk, the richest man in the world today. Chinese magnates have been aligned with Xi Jinping even longer. The influence of the Chinese government on the march of the country’s companies is even clearer and the AI ​​rise is probably the engine of this “repositioning.” His strategic value is evident, and the Chinese president now seems to want to give more margin of maneuver to private companies that are allowing him to compete in better conditions with his great rival, United States.
